OpenRGB强力统一:如何终结RGB设备控制碎片化困境?
2026/5/4 4:57:57 网站建设 项目流程

OpenRGB强力统一:如何终结RGB设备控制碎片化困境?

【免费下载链接】OpenRGBOpen source RGB lighting control that doesn't depend on manufacturer software. Supports Windows, Linux, MacOS. Mirror of https://gitlab.com/CalcProgrammer1/OpenRGB. Releases can be found on GitLab.项目地址: https://gitcode.com/gh_mirrors/op/OpenRGB

还在为电脑中安装多个RGB控制软件而苦恼吗?当雷蛇键盘需要Synapse、海盗船内存需要iCUE、华硕主板需要Armoury Crate同时运行时,系统资源被大量占用,软件冲突频发。OpenRGB作为一款革命性的开源RGB灯光控制解决方案,正在重新定义设备管理标准,让用户真正掌控自己的RGB生态系统。

现实困境:多品牌RGB设备的控制混乱

现代电脑配置往往涉及多个品牌的RGB设备:主板控制板载灯效、显卡管理自身灯光、内存条需要专用软件、外设又有各自的控制平台。这种碎片化的管理方式不仅消耗宝贵的系统资源,更让用户陷入无尽的软件切换中。

从这张实际运行截图可以看到,OpenRGB成功整合了雷蛇猎魂精英键盘、曼巴精英鼠标、烈焰神虫鼠标垫、北海巨妖7.1耳机等多个设备,实现了真正的统一管理界面。

技术突破:开源架构带来的设备兼容性革命

OpenRGB的核心优势在于其模块化的设备控制器架构。项目的Controllers目录下包含了数百个针对不同品牌和型号的专用控制器实现,每个控制器都经过精心设计,确保与对应设备的完美兼容。

跨平台底层适配

针对不同操作系统,OpenRGB提供了专门的底层接口实现:

  • Linux系统通过i2c_smbus模块直接访问硬件
  • Windows平台利用厂商提供的API接口
  • MacOS系统则采用相应的系统级调用

这种设计确保了无论用户使用什么操作系统,都能获得一致的使用体验。

实践指南:从零开始构建统一RGB系统

环境准备与软件部署

对于新手用户,推荐从预编译版本开始体验。如果需要最新功能,可以通过源码编译安装:

git clone https://gitcode.com/gh_mirrors/op/OpenRGB cd OpenRGB mkdir build && cd build qmake ../OpenRGB.pro make -j$(nproc) sudo make install

设备识别与权限配置

首次启动时,OpenRGB会自动扫描系统并识别所有可用的RGB设备。如果某些设备未被识别,可以尝试以下步骤:

  1. 检查设备物理连接状态
  2. 确认设备在支持列表中
  3. 配置系统访问权限

个性化配置实战

通过直观的可视化界面,用户可以:

  • 为每个设备单独设置灯光效果
  • 创建全局同步的灯光主题
  • 保存和恢复不同的使用场景配置

核心功能解析:OpenRGB的技术实现亮点

设备控制器架构

每个设备控制器都遵循相同的设计模式:

  • 设备检测模块负责识别设备
  • 通信模块处理与设备的交互
  • 灯光控制模块实现各种效果

配置管理系统

ProfileManager模块提供了强大的配置管理功能:

  • 场景化配置保存
  • 一键切换不同模式
  • 自动备份重要设置

高级应用:释放OpenRGB的完整潜力

多场景智能切换

创建针对不同使用场景的灯光配置:

  • 专注工作模式:柔和的单色灯光,减少视觉干扰
  • 沉浸游戏模式:动态多彩效果,增强游戏体验
  • 创意娱乐模式:随音乐律动的灯光秀

自动化控制方案

通过命令行接口实现批量设备管理:

  • 设置开机自启动特定效果
  • 与其他软件实现联动控制
  • 创建定时切换的灯光方案

故障排除与优化建议

常见问题快速解决

设备识别失败时:

  • 检查设备是否在最新支持列表中
  • 确认系统权限配置正确
  • 尝试手动添加设备配置

性能优化技巧

  • 关闭不必要的设备检测
  • 合理设置扫描间隔
  • 使用轻量级灯光效果

技术前瞻:RGB控制的未来发展方向

OpenRGB不仅仅是一个工具,更代表了一种理念:用户应该对自己的硬件拥有完全的控制权。随着项目的持续发展,更多设备和功能将被支持,为用户提供更完善的RGB控制体验。

无论你是追求极致性能的电竞玩家、注重效率的办公用户,还是热爱技术的DIY爱好者,OpenRGB都能为你提供完美的RGB控制解决方案。告别厂商软件的束缚,开始你的RGB自由控制之旅。

【免费下载链接】OpenRGBOpen source RGB lighting control that doesn't depend on manufacturer software. Supports Windows, Linux, MacOS. Mirror of https://gitlab.com/CalcProgrammer1/OpenRGB. Releases can be found on GitLab.项目地址: https://gitcode.com/gh_mirrors/op/OpenRGB

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询